Method for manufacturing right-angled pulp product
A method for manufacturing a right-angled pulp product uses a mixture of cellulose fibers as pulp. Steps in the method include taking the pulp to form a flat shape, pressing and heat-drying the flat-shaped pulp to form a pulp product having a plurality of troughs, taking out the pulp product, cutting off a burr around the pulp product, applying adhesive onto each of the troughs, and bending two adjacent plates at two sides of each trough to form a right angle and a fixed shape.
Pulp molding process and paper-shaped article made thereby
A pulp molding process and a paper-shaped article made thereby are provided. The pulp molding process comprises the steps of providing a composite having at least one fiber material, performing a pulp-dredging step including a first pre-compression forming step, performing a compression thermo-forming step, and performing an edge-cutting step for forming a paper-shaped article, wherein the composite comprises 20 to 99 parts by weight of a superior short fiber material for forming the paper-shaped article for eliminating the crosslinking effect. The paper-shaped article made by the pulp molding process comprises a cave having a transversal width of from 0.5 mm to 8 mm.

Solid articles from poly alpha-1,3-glucan and wood pulp
A solid article formed from poly alpha-1,3-glucan and wood pulp is disclosed as are methods for making the solid article. The articles are not water sensitive and are useful for producing strong molded articles from wood pulp.

Lignocellulosic article and method of producing same
A lignocellulosic article comprises a plurality of lignocellulosic pieces and a binding agent disposed on the plurality of lignocellulosic pieces. The binding agent is formed from a high temperature polymerization (HTP) polyol and an isocyanate component. A method of producing the lignocellulosic article is also disclosed.

Wet blank flipping method for manufacturing molded pulp products and pulp molding machine
A wet blank flipping method for manufacturing pulp molded products, which follows these steps: after the wet blank is formed in the suction filtration forming mold, it is transferred to the hot-pressing shaping device for hot-press drying and shaping to create pulp molded products, characterized in that: said transfer is done using a first wet blank transfer device and a second wet blank transfer device to move the wet blank from the suction filtration forming mold to the hot-pressing shaping device; wherein, the first wet blank transfer device extracts the wet blank from the suction filtration forming mold and transfers it to the second wet blank transfer device, which then moves the wet blank to the hot-pressing shaping device.
